阿里云 centos mysql 5.6_关于centOS安装配置mysql5.6那点事
关于centOS安装配置mysql5.6那点事
第一步 下载安装
一、主要因为现在mysql官网yum直接推送mysql8,mysql5.1,然而mysql8不稳定,mysql5.1版本又太低,要想用旧版本5.6就先下载相应的依赖包,安装好依赖包,更改默认版本号后,再安装。故总结就是通过官网下载依赖包+yum安装的方式。
1.yum list | grep mysql
2.https://dev.mysql.com/downloads/repo/yum 下载依赖包
3.rpm -ivh 依赖包
注意:此时安装rpm依赖包就和windows下安装exe一样,会自动安装到相应的目录,不用指定安装目录(例如/opt)
4.yum repolist enabled | grep “mysql.*-community.*” 查询mysql安装相关依赖
5.vi /etc/yum.repos.d/mysql-community.repo 更改默认版本号 mysql5.6对应的enabled=1 mysql8对应的enable=0
6.改 mysql 5.6 enable=1 改mysql8 enable=0 修改配置文件指定软件版本
7.yum install mysql-server
注意:如果报错重新运行yum install mysql-server
8.进入centOs系统数据库Mysql,此时用nevicat连centos中的数据库会报2003错误
解决办法:以root身份进入centos系统数据库mysql -u root -p
9.授予其他远程连接电脑权限:
mysql> GRANT ALL PRIVILEGES ON *.* TO ‘root’@’%’ IDENTIFIED BY ‘123456’ WITH GRANT OPTION;
其中’123456’为重置的root用户的密码
10.若此时用nevicat连centos中的数据库还是要报2003错误
解决办法:关闭防火墙 service iptables stop 一定会连接成功,如果不成功可以联系我
第二步 配置命令总结
1.修改mysql root的密码 mysqladmin -u root password ‘new-password’
2.查看mysql进程是否启动:ps -ef | grep -i “mysqld”
3.修改mysql root用户远程启动权限
法一:通过更改user表
use mysql;
select user,host from user;
注意:如果只是修改host名为虚拟机名的那条记录(把host改为%)会导致远程终端连接时连不上(报1045错误),所以此时需要完整地添加一条user为root,host为%的完整信息之后再刷新权限
法二:通过命令
GRANT ALL PRIVILEGES ON *.*TO’root’@’%’IDENTIFIED BY ‘123456’ WITH GRANT OPTION;
flush privileges 刷新权限表 或重启mysql service mysqld start
quit
4.查看mysql是否已经安装:rpm -qa | grep -i “mysql”
5.启动mysql:chkconfig mysqld on
service mysqld start
6.以root用户登录:mysql -u root -p
mysql -u root password “密码”
阿里云 centos mysql 5.6_关于centOS安装配置mysql5.6那点事相关推荐
- 阿里云Ubuntu的Xshell的JAVA8下载安装配置(超详细)和Tomcat
写在前面:今天小明查了很多教程,装了很多版本,最后,小明重装了服务器的系统盘.小明刚刚终于装上,十分感动,所以出一个非常非常基础的教程.重点在Xshell的命令行键入. 资源链接:JAVA8+Tomc ...
- 阿里云服务器 ECS 部署lamp:centos+apache+mysql+php安装配置方法 (centos7)
阿里云服务器 ECS 部署lamp:centos+apache+mysql+php安装配置方法 (centos7) 1.效果图 1 2. 部署步骤 1 1. mysql安装附加(centos7) 7 ...
- 阿里云 远程 mysql_阿里云 远程mysql
关于 阿里云 远程mysql的搜索结果 问题 在阿里云服务器上安装mysql.redis 远程连接都失败 不知是怎么回事?安全组端口号也配置了 在阿里云服务器上安装mysql.redis 远程连接都失 ...
- 阿里云 远程mysql_阿里云远程mysql
关于 阿里云远程mysql的搜索结果 问题 在阿里云服务器上安装mysql.redis 远程连接都失败 不知是怎么回事?安全组端口号也配置了 在阿里云服务器上安装mysql.redis 远程连接都失败 ...
- 阿里云重启mysql_阿里云RDS Mysql 5.6 ECS自建从库(不锁表,不重启)
注意:你的备份的时间应该在你的binlog保存时间范围内 环境: 主库: 阿里云RDS Mysql 5.6 从库: ECS机器上自建从库 Centos 7.4 setp 1 在阿里云RDS后台建立只读 ...
- 阿里云数据库Mysql被黑
阿里云数据库Mysql被黑 打开Mysql查看数据库时,发现所有的服务器上的数据库被黑 百度翻译了一下: 总结一下: 以下是常用的可以保护数据库的方式,供参考.可以有效防止被攻击. 1.密码强化,使用 ...
- 十年磨一剑,阿里云RDS MySQL和AWS RDS谁的性能更胜一筹?
MySQL代表了开源数据库的快速发展. 从2004年前后的Wiki.WordPress等轻量级Web 2.0应用起步,到2010年阿里巴巴在电商及支付场景大规模使用MySQL数据库,再到2012年开始 ...
- 阿里云ECS代理访问阿里云RDS MySQL数据库
一.前言 阿里云RDS数据白名单一般只对内部的服务器开放,一般不会开放给外网直接访问,有时开发需要直接访问RDS数据库,平时我们使用的网络都是动态公网IP,经常会变化,设置白名单相对繁琐一点.想了一个 ...
- 阿里云服务器安装mysql数据库教程
阿里云服务器怎么安装mysql数据库?阿里云服务器ECS如何安装mysql数据库教程.主机教程网下面就来分享一下阿里云服务器安装mysql数据库教程. 第一步 1.登录个人的阿里云服务管理终端 2.点 ...
最新文章
- 一块GPU就能训练语义分割网络,百度PaddlePaddle是如何优化的?
- QApplicationQPushButton
- C# textBox1.Append/Text实现换行
- 界面设计方法 (2) — 4.界面设计的原则与标准
- CSU 1114 平方根大搜索
- java主动对象模式_POCO的主动对象
- hyperion卫星重访时间_观摩卫星发射|2020第四届全球物联网大会上让我们一起去“放星”...
- 博客搬家——从CSDN到博客园
- switchhosts以管理员身份运行后不显示故障处理
- 51单片机初学之流水灯程序
- 修复win7更新服务器失败,win7的windows update无法启动,手动在服务里启动提示“错误2:系统找不到指定文件...
- 微服务下蓝绿部署、红黑部署、AB测试、灰度发布、金丝雀发布、滚动发布的概念与区别...
- 如何启动单线程实现多线程效果及保证安全?
- 个人邮箱|如何群发邮件?3秒教你搞定
- dw html怎么导入视频,如何在dw中将视频插入
- usb设备复合g_webcam摄像头码流传输功能以及g_serial串口功能
- THREE.ShaderMaterial
- 2021 ICPC Asia Taipei Regional
- 【企业数字化转型】网络协同和数据智能双螺旋驱动——活数据:流动创造价值...
- 什么是 ML.NET?应该如何理解机器学习基础知识?